About Dr. Imam

Dr. Asher Imam, D.O., F.A.A.N., is an experienced neurologist and neurophysiologist, specializing in neurology, clinical neurophysiology, vascular neurology, and sleep medicine. He is also the president and founder of Southlake Neurology & Sleep Wellness Clinic in Southlake, Texas. 

At Southlake Neurology & Neurophysiology Clinic, Dr. Imam focuses on the diagnosis and treatment of acute and chronic neurological disorders, including epilepsy, multiple sclerosis, sleep disorders, and chronic headaches. He also served as the director of Baylor-Grapevine Comprehensive Epilepsy and Sleep Disorders Center in Grapevine, Texas. There, Dr. Imam treated patients with sleep and epileptic disorders while maintaining the integrity of the program by educating staff technicians and their certifications. He also served as a director of neurosciences at Baylor Scott and White Medical Center in Grapevine, Texas for 9 years where he started the stroke program. Dr. Imam also started the first stroke certified (Joint Commission) in Tarrant County at Medical Center of Arlington. He has been recognized as a Top Doctor by Fort Worth magazine and has received several awards for his compassionate approach to care and his dedication to patient satisfaction. Dr. Imam is a clinical adjunct professor of neurosciences at TCU-UNTHSC School of Medicine.
